About the Department
The Department of Clinical Nutrition offers well-established and nationally respected academic programs. The Master's of Clinical Nutrition coordinated program consistently attracts highly qualified students from across the country, along with the newer online Master's of Nutritional Health. The Department also operates a clinical practice, with strong research collaborations with the UT Southwestern Center for Human Nutrition. About UT Southwestern
UT Southwestern Medical Center is one of the nation’s premier academic health systems, integrating pioneering research, exceptional clinical care, and innovative education. Consistently ranked among the top institutions for rehabilitative care by U.S. News & World Report, UT Southwestern is committed to excellence, discovery, and teamwork. Located in the Southwestern Medical District—a 400-acre medical complex just minutes from downtown Dallas — UT Southwestern collaborates with major affiliated health systems, including: UT Southwestern University Hospitals, Parkland Health, Children’s Health, Texas Health Resources, VA North Texas Health Care System.
